Model based control using C2000 microcontroller

    Research output: Chapter in Book/Report/Conference proceedingConference contribution

    Abstract

    A model based control is used to control a complex system which has a large settling time. The system that is shown in this paper is a drum boiler system integrated with a solar water heating system to provide pre-heated feed water as input to it. Thus, making a hybrid energy system where energy conservation is obtained by the use of solar energy in conventional thermal power plants. Matlab/Simulink is used to model the plant dynamics and use the same model to estimate current state and validate the real time results by the use of processor in loop simulation.
